This standard specifies pressure-temperature rating, materials, design requirements, inspection and test, marking as well as non-destructive inspection and repair of industrial steel valves. This standard is applicable to materials given in Table 1 (valve body may be cast, forged, welded in combination; flanged, threaded and welding end connection may be adopted as the end connection) and wafer type and single-flange valves. Parameter ranges applicable to valves in this standard are as follows: a) For the valves with nominal pressure PN16~PN760, the nominal pressure PN760 is only applicable to welding end valves; b) Valves on flange connection ends and valves on butt welding ends with nominal size not greater than DN1250; c) Valves on socket weld ends and valves on threaded connection ends with nominal size not greater than DN65; d) Valves on threaded connection ends with rated temperature and nominal pressure not greater than 540℃ and PN420 respectively; e) Valves on flange connection ends with nominal pressure PN16~PN25 and rated temperature not greater than 540℃.
